Agrifood systems — Emissions (CO2eq) in Fiji
Fiji: Agrifood systems — Emissions (CO2eq) was 1,049 kt in 2023. ▼ Falling
Agrifood systems — Emissions (CO2eq) in Fiji, 1990–2023
Source: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ations. Measured in kt.
Analysis
The most recent figure for agrifood systems — emissions (co2eq) in Fiji is 1,049 kt, measured in 2023.
That represents a change of up 9.5% on the previous year and down 20.1% over ten years.
Over the whole period, agrifood systems — emissions (co2eq) in Fiji peaked at 1,401 kt in 1997 and was at its lowest, 787.3 kt, in 2014.
That places Fiji 163rd out of 222 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 34 years of available data.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 1,302 kt | 1,171 kt | 1,401 kt | 10 |
| 2000s | 1,335 kt | 1,305 kt | 1,360 kt | 10 |
| 2010s | 1,041 kt | 787.3 kt | 1,330 kt | 10 |
| 2020s | 957.02 kt | 897.21 kt | 1,049 kt | 4 |

About this data
The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ions Totals summarizes the gre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ions disseminated in the FAOSTAT Climate Change domains of emissions from agrifood systems. Data are computed following the Tier 1 methods of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) Guidelines for National greenhouse gas (GHG) Inventories (IPCC, 1996; 1997; 2000; 2002; 2006; 2014). Emissions from other economic sectors as defined by the IPCC are also disseminated in the domain for completeness.
